Key Features & Benefits
1. High-Wattage Performance (50W)
This strip draws nearly double the power of the 3528 versions. This results in a "punchy" light that can easily illuminate countertops from underneath a cabinet. Because of the 50W draw, the included UK transformer is robust and specifically matched to handle the higher current.
2. IP65 Waterproofing
The "6" means it is dust-tight, and the "5" means it is protected against low-pressure water jets. This makes it the perfect choice for:
Kitchens: Safe from steam and splashes from the sink or stovetop.
Bathrooms: Safe for use as "under-vanity" lighting or "behind-mirror" glows (Zone 2/3).
Shelving: Easy to wipe clean if dust accumulates on the silicone coating.
3. Warm White Aesthetics
Unlike "Cool White" which has a blueish, clinical tint, "Warm White" mimics the golden glow of traditional halogen or incandescent bulbs. It is specifically designed to make spaces feel comfortable and is the most popular choice for domestic living areas.
Installation Tips for High-Power Strips
Heat Dissipation: Because this is a 50W strip, it can become quite warm during long periods of use. For the longest lifespan, mounting it inside an Alluminum Profile (Channel) is highly recommended. The metal acts as a "heat sink," pulling heat away from the LEDs.
Voltage Drop Check: If you plan to connect two of these kits together to make a 10-meter run, you must power them from the centre or provide power to both ends. Connecting 10 meters in a single line will result in the far end being noticeably dimmer.
Cutting: Ensure you only cut on the designated copper pads. Since this is an IP65 strip, you will need to peel back or cut through a small layer of silicone to make your connection.
